namespace souffle {
class RecordTable;
class IOSystem {
public:
static IOSystem& getInstance() {
static IOSystem singleton;
return singleton;
}
void registerWriteStreamFactory(const std::shared_ptr<WriteStreamFactory>& factory) {
outputFactories[factory->getName()] = factory;
}
void registerReadStreamFactory(const std::shared_ptr<ReadStreamFactory>& factory) {
inputFactories[factory->getName()] = factory;
}
/**
* Return a new WriteStream
*/
std::unique_ptr<WriteStream> getWriter(const std::map<std::string, std::string>& rwOperation,
const SymbolTable& symbolTable, const RecordTable& recordTable) const {
std::string ioType = rwOperation.at("IO");
if (outputFactories.count(ioType) == 0) {
throw std::invalid_argument("Requested output type <" + ioType + "> is not supported.");
}
return outputFactories.at(ioType)->getWriter(rwOperation, symbolTable, recordTable);
}
/**
* Return a new ReadStream
*/
std::unique_ptr<ReadStream> getReader(const std::map<std::string, std::string>& rwOperation,
SymbolTable& symbolTable, RecordTable& recordTable) const {
std::string ioType = rwOperation.at("IO");
if (inputFactories.count(ioType) == 0) {
throw std::invalid_argument("Requested input type <" + ioType + "> is not supported.");
}
return inputFactories.at(ioType)->getReader(rwOperation, symbolTable, recordTable);
}
~IOSystem() = default;
private:
IOSystem() {
registerReadStreamFactory(std::make_shared<ReadFileCSVFactory>());
registerReadStreamFactory(std::make_shared<ReadCinCSVFactory>());
registerWriteStreamFactory(std::make_shared<WriteFileCSVFactory>());
registerWriteStreamFactory(std::make_shared<WriteCoutCSVFactory>());
registerWriteStreamFactory(std::make_shared<WriteCoutPrintSizeFactory>());
#ifdef USE_SQLITE
registerReadStreamFactory(std::make_shared<ReadSQLiteFactory>());
registerWriteStreamFactory(std::make_shared<WriteSQLiteFactory>());
#endif
};
std::map<std::string, std::shared_ptr<WriteStreamFactory>> outputFactories;
std::map<std::string, std::shared_ptr<ReadStreamFactory>> inputFactories;
};
} /* namespace souffle */
